Boston Police report a 46-year-old man was taken away with "life-threatening injuries" following a collision around 4:30 p.m. at Melnea Cass. Boulevard and Mass. Ave. - about a block away from Boston Medical Center.

They basically have to treat it as a homicide scene
By Pete Nice
Tue, 09/21/2010 - 1:59pm
if there is a potential that someone could die. For obvious reasons, crashes that involve pedestrians and cyclists tend to involve more serious injuries that lead to deaths.
They can take a lot of the measurments at a later time, but they need to photograph everything that is at the scene before they can do that. And obviously they have to mark where everything is before so they can take measurments later.
